چگونه بفهمم سرور لینوکس من خراب شده است؟
گزارش ها را بررسی کنید
هنگامی که همه چیز با شکست مواجه می شود، غربال کردن لاگ های سرور خود یکی از بهترین راه ها برای عیب یابی هر گونه خطا است. معمولاً فایلها در دایرکتوریهای /var/log/syslog و /var/log/ قرار میگیرند.
لاگ های خرابی لینوکس کجا هستند؟
می توانید همه پیام ها را در /var/log/syslog و سایر فایل های /var/log/ پیدا کنید. پیام های قدیمی در /var/log/syslog هستند. 1، /var/log/syslog. 2.
چگونه می توانم بفهمم چرا سرورم خراب شده است؟
در زیر شایع ترین دلایل خرابی سرور ذکر شده است:
- اشکال شبکه این یکی از رایج ترین مشکلاتی است که ممکن است منجر به خرابی سرور شود. …
- اضافه بار سیستم گاهی اوقات، به دلیل بارگذاری بیش از حد سیستم، سرور ممکن است ساعت ها طول بکشد. …
- خطاهای پیکربندی …
- مسائل سخت افزاری …
- پشتیبان گیری …
- گرم شدن بیش از حد. ...
- خطای افزونه. …
- شکستن کد.
8 یوان. 2017
چگونه گزارش های خرابی را در اوبونتو مشاهده کنم؟
برای مشاهده گزارش های سیستم روی تب syslog کلیک کنید. می توانید با استفاده از کنترل ctrl+F یک گزارش خاص را جستجو کنید و سپس کلمه کلیدی را وارد کنید. هنگامی که یک رویداد گزارش جدید ایجاد می شود، به طور خودکار به لیست گزارش ها اضافه می شود و می توانید آن را به صورت پررنگ مشاهده کنید.
چگونه Dmesg را در لینوکس اجرا کنم؟
ترمینال را باز کنید و دستور 'dmesg' را تایپ کنید و سپس اینتر را بزنید. در صفحه نمایش خود، تمام پیام های بافر حلقه هسته را دریافت خواهید کرد.
چگونه فایل های لاگ را در لینوکس تجزیه و تحلیل کنم؟
خواندن فایل های گزارش
- فرمان "گربه". شما به راحتی می توانید یک فایل log را "cat" کنید تا به سادگی آن را باز کنید. …
- فرمان "دم". ساده ترین دستوری که می توانید برای مشاهده فایل لاگ خود از آن استفاده کنید دستور "tail" است. …
- فرمان "بیشتر" و "کمتر". …
- فرمان "سر". …
- ترکیب دستور grep با دستورات دیگر. …
- دستور "مرتب". …
- فرمان "awk". …
- فرمان "uniq".
28 آوریل 2017 г.
چگونه یک فایل گزارش را مشاهده کنم؟
از آنجایی که اکثر فایلهای گزارش به صورت متن ساده ضبط میشوند، استفاده از هر ویرایشگر متنی برای باز کردن آن به خوبی انجام میشود. به طور پیش فرض، ویندوز از Notepad برای باز کردن یک فایل LOG با دوبار کلیک کردن روی آن استفاده می کند.
چگونه تاریخچه ورود را در لینوکس پیدا کنم؟
چگونه تاریخچه ورود کاربران را در لینوکس بررسی کنیم؟
- /var/run/utmp: حاوی اطلاعاتی در مورد کاربرانی است که در حال حاضر وارد سیستم شده اند. دستور Who برای واکشی اطلاعات از فایل استفاده می شود.
- /var/log/wtmp: حاوی utmp تاریخی است. تاریخچه ورود و خروج کاربران را حفظ می کند. …
- /var/log/btmp: شامل تلاشهای بد برای ورود است.
6 نوامبر 2013 г.
چگونه وضعیت syslog خود را بررسی کنم؟
میتوانید از ابزار pidof برای بررسی اینکه آیا تقریباً هر برنامهای در حال اجرا است یا خیر استفاده کنید (اگر حداقل یک pid ارائه کند، برنامه در حال اجرا است). اگر از syslog-ng استفاده می کنید، این pidof syslog-ng است. اگر از syslogd استفاده می کنید، pidof syslogd خواهد بود. /etc/init. وضعیت d/rsyslog [ خوب ] rsyslogd در حال اجرا است.
چگونه سرور خراب شده را تعمیر کنم؟
در اینجا روش رایج برای رفع خرابی سرور آمده است:
- اگر سرور در حال روشن شدن است، گزارش های سرور را بررسی کنید تا متوجه شوید که خطای نرم افزاری یا سخت افزاری چیست و اقدام کنید.
- اگر سرور روشن نمی شود، با سرور مانند دسکتاپ رفتار کنید و ببینید آیا با تعویض رم و منبع تغذیه مشکل برق برطرف می شود یا خیر.
15 اکتبر 2011 г.
چرا سرورها از کار می افتند؟
چرا سرورها از کار می افتند در حالی که سرورها به دلایل زیادی از کار می افتند، مشکلات زیست محیطی و نگهداری نادرست اغلب ریشه اصلی خرابی ها هستند. شرایطی که باعث خرابی سرور می شود عبارتند از: محیط بیش از حد گرم - عدم خنک کننده مناسب می تواند سرورها را بیش از حد گرم کرده و آسیب ببیند. … خرابی قطعات سخت افزاری یا نرم افزاری.
مشکل سرور چیست؟
مشکل از سرور است
خطای سرور داخلی خطایی در سرور وب است که میخواهید به آن دسترسی پیدا کنید. آن سرور به نحوی به درستی پیکربندی نشده است که از پاسخگویی مناسب به آنچه شما میخواهید جلوگیری میکند.
چگونه گزارش های syslog را مشاهده کنم؟
دستور var/log/syslog را صادر کنید تا همه چیز را در زیر syslog مشاهده کنید، اما بزرگنمایی روی یک موضوع خاص کمی طول میکشد، زیرا این فایل معمولا طولانی است. میتوانید از Shift+G برای رسیدن به انتهای فایل استفاده کنید که با «END» مشخص میشود. شما همچنین می توانید گزارش ها را از طریق dmesg مشاهده کنید، که بافر حلقه هسته را چاپ می کند.
چگونه یک فایل syslog را بخوانم؟
برای انجام این کار، می توانید به سرعت دستور کمتر /var/log/syslog را صادر کنید. این دستور فایل log syslog را به بالا باز می کند. سپس میتوانید از کلیدهای جهتنما برای پیمایش یک خط به پایین، از نوار فاصله برای پیمایش یک صفحه به پایین یا از چرخ ماوس برای پیمایش آسان در فایل استفاده کنید.
syslog در اوبونتو کجاست؟
گزارش سیستم معمولاً حاوی بیشترین اطلاعات به طور پیش فرض در مورد سیستم اوبونتو شما است. این در /var/log/syslog قرار دارد و ممکن است حاوی اطلاعاتی باشد که سایر گزارشها ندارند.